Sound Barrier Installation in Longmont, CO
Sound barrier installation services involve adding specialized barriers to reduce noise pollution on residential properties. These barriers can be constructed using various materials such as wood, vinyl, or concrete, and are designed to block or absorb sound from sources like busy roads, nearby train tracks, or loud outdoor equipment. Projects typically include installing sound walls along property boundaries, around outdoor living areas, or near driveways and garages to create quieter, more comfortable outdoor spaces. Homeowners interested in sound barrier installation should consider factors like the location of noise sources, property layout, and desired level of noise reduction to determine the most effective solutions.
Before requesting sound barrier installation, property owners usually want to understand the different types of barriers available and their suitability for specific environments. It’s helpful to assess the size and placement of the barrier, as well as any local regulations or restrictions that might apply. Additionally, understanding the durability and maintenance requirements of various materials can influence the choice of barrier. Clear communication about the goals for noise reduction and the specific areas to be covered can assist in selecting the most appropriate and effective soundproofing solutions for the property.

Sound Barrier Installation Questions
What types of sound barriers are available for installation? Various options include solid panels, fencing, and specialized acoustic barriers designed to reduce noise from nearby roads or neighbors.
Can sound barriers be installed around existing structures? Yes, sound barriers can be added around existing fences, walls, or property boundaries to enhance noise reduction.
What are common projects for sound barrier installation? Typical projects involve reducing traffic noise near homes, screening outdoor living areas, or creating quiet zones in residential properties.
What should property owners consider before installing a sound barrier? Consider the location, size, and material of the barrier to ensure effective noise reduction and compatibility with property aesthetics.
